Ritchie Blackmore's Rainbow

Ritchie Blackmore's Rainbow is the brainchild of the legendary guitarist Ritchie Blackmore, who is best known for his work with iconic bands such as Deep Purple and Rainbow. With a career spanning over four decades, Blackmore has solidified his status as a guitar god in the world of rock music. Blackmore's Rainbow, formed in 1975, has gone through various lineup changes over the years, with Blackmore being the only constant member. The band's signature blend of hard rock and medieval-inspired music has captivated audiences around the world, earning them a dedicated fanbase and critical acclaim. Known for his virtuosic guitar playing and enigmatic stage presence, Blackmore has influenced countless musicians and has left an indelible mark on the rock music genre. From the blistering riffs of "Man on the Silver Mountain" to the epic balladry of "Catch the Rainbow," Blackmore's Rainbow showcases the full range of Blackmore's musical prowess. The band's live performances are a sight to behold, with Blackmore shredding on his signature Fender Stratocaster and commanding the stage with a magnetic energy that is truly unparalleled.
